中文摘要:
      目的 建立超高效液相色谱-飞行时间质谱法检测山药中7种常见杀菌剂的分析方法。方法 样品经乙腈提取, 70 ℃水浴氮吹至近干, 丙酮溶解后, 经超高效液相色谱-飞行时间质谱检测。结果 不同温度(50、70 ℃)水浴实验结果表明70 ℃水浴温度符合实验要求。在正离子模式下, 7种杀菌剂在水-甲醇(均含有0.01%甲酸和5 mmol/L甲酸铵)流动相中都具有较好的响应; 各化合物在0.01~0.40 mg/L范围内线性良好, 相关系数r均大于0.999。3个浓度水平的加标回收实验的回收率为70.75%~108.07%, 相对标准偏差为0.02%~5.01%。结论 该方法操作简单、分析准确, 满足山药中常见杀菌剂的检测要求。
英文摘要:
      Objective To establish a method for determination of 7 kinds of common fungicides residues in Chinese yam by ultra performance liquid chromatography-time of flight mass spectrometry (UPLC-TOF-MS). Methods The sample was extracted by acetonitrile, then it was blown by nitrogen at 70 ℃ water bath to nearly dry. The solution was redissolved with acetone and determined by UPLC-TOF-MS. Results The experimental results of water bath at different temperatures (50, 70 ℃) showed that the temperature of water bath at 70 ℃ met the experimental requirements. In the positive ion mode, the seven fungicides all responded well in the mobile phase of water-methanol (containing 0.01% formic acid and 5 mmol/L ammonium formate). Each compound had good linearity in the range of 0.01?0.40 mg/L, and the correlation coefficients r were greater than 0.999. The recoveries of the 3 concentration levels of the standard addition recovery experiment were 70.75%?108.07%, and the relative standard deviations were 0.02%?5.01%. Conclusion This method is simple and accurate, and can meet the requirement of detecting common fungicides in Chinese yam.
